Wrap is tatty, one slip joint is tack welded as the "ear" needs rewelding. The tack weld was a temporary repair, pending removal from the car, but I decided to go with new RCM headers to match my new 2.5 engine. Quality piece of kit with plenty of slip joints, 4-2-1 design, still has slightly off beat idle sound, but then sounds more like a straight four at high revs. Excellent spool, was getting 1bar at 3000rpm on a 2.0 with a TD05/20G
£175 ono, collection preferred, otherwise I will have to dismantle to post them!
